qtquickcontrols

    1热度

    1回答

    我的一些应用程序设置QMLWindow和在这里工作的是简约的工作代码: import QtQuick 2.5 import QtQuick.Controls 1.4 import QtQuick.Layouts 1.1 import QtQuick.Window 2.2 import QtQuick.Controls.Styles 1.4 Window { width: 5

    0热度

    1回答

    我想从另一个文件中动态加载标签到TabView中。为此,我使用Qt.createComponent并将该组件添加到视图中。该选项卡已加载,但其内容不显示,并且已正确加载。就像这样: TabView { id:editor Layout.minimumWidth: 50 Layout.fillWidth: true } Component.onCompleted:

    0热度

    2回答

    我是QtQuick控件的新手,我想创建一个简单的GUI,并遇到以下问题,将某些C++变量绑定到qml小部件属性: 下面简单的例子,我有一个单独的组合框,我想分配一个项目列表,并且能够设置从应用程序的C++端选择哪个项目。 对于test_list/model对,一切正如我所料,但对于test_index/currentIndex它不是。在test_index被设置为2并且调用通知之后,没有任何事情发

    2热度

    1回答

    我想给我自己的风格Tumbler。我宣布Tumbler这样的: Tumbler { style: MyTumblerStyle {} height: UIConstants.smallFontSize * 10 width: UIConstants.smallFontSize * 3 TumblerColumn { model: [0,1,2,

    0热度

    1回答

    如何在菜单中添加通用的Qt Quick控件? 喜欢的东西: ApplicationWindow { visible: true menu: Menu { MenuItem { } Slider { } Button { } } } 与 “标准” 的Qt,你可以这样做与QWidgetAction。

    2热度

    1回答

    我查看了类似的线程,但没有多大帮助。 我在QML中使用QtQuick.Controls.Button,当悬停在按钮上时,我无法更改光标形状!我想在不使用MouseArea的情况下实现此目的。可以做什么?当我查看文档时,我无法找到属性或类似的cursorShape属性。

    1热度

    1回答

    将TextField置于RowLayout之后,我无法再调整TextField的大小。我试图设置anchor s为TextField来填充RowLayout的左侧和它的中心,使它成为的width的一半,但它变得刚好大于它的一半。 现在我试图将TextField的width绑定到RowLayout,但该元素仍然没有调整大小。当我从其父母那里取TextField时,它的大小调整正常。这是一个Qt的错误

    -1热度

    2回答

    有一个问题的自包含例如: Rectangle { id: rect width: 200 height: 200 property real v : 50 onVChanged: console.log(v) Button { onClicked: scomp.createObject(rect) } Co

    1热度

    1回答

    我试图让TableView(QtQuick.Controls)显示网格线(水平和垂直)。我玩过风格,项目/行/头代表,但无法找到如何去做。是否有可能使用内置的功能,或者我必须以某种方式自己实现它? 编辑 目前结束了这段代码: import QtQuick 2.5 import QtQuick.Controls 1.4 import QtQuick.Controls.Sty

    1热度

    1回答

    的元素我有一个QML对象如下: // File: ControlView.qml Rectangle { id: view property bool darkBackground: false Text { id: textSingleton } SoundEffect { id: playCalSound